ColdFusion Cross-Site Scripting Protection Bypass Vulnerability |
||
|
Checks for an XSS flaw in ColdFusion Detailed Explanation for this Vulnerability Assessment Summary : The remote web server is vulnerable to a cross-site scripting attack. Description : The remote web server contains a script that fails to completely sanitize user input before using it to generate dynamic content. An unauthenticated remote attacker may be able to leverage this issue to inject arbitrary HTML or script code into a user's browser to be executed within the security context of the affected site. See also : http://archives.neohapsis.com/archives/fulldisclosure/2006-12/0203.html Solution : Unknown at this time. Network Security Threat Level: Low / CVSS Base Score : 2 (AV:R/AC:H/Au:NR/C:N/I:P/A:N/B:N) Networks Security ID: 21532 Vulnerability Assessment Copyright: This script is Copyright (C) 2007 Tenable Network Security |
